The Head of Data Science will lead the Data Science department, driving data-driven decision-making and delivering impactful insights within the public sector. This role in Birmingham requires expertise in data science methodologies and a strong ability to manage and develop analytics teams. Hybrid working is also available in Cardiff or London.
The organisation is a well-established public sector entity with a significant focus on leveraging data to improve services and inform strategic decisions. As an organisation, they are committed to fostering innovation and maintaining high operational standards.
Description
- Support the Director of Risk, Data Analysis and Insight to develop the analysis programme in line with the overall Strategic Plan.
- Lead and manage the Data Science department, ensuring the delivery of high-quality data insights.
- Develop and implement data science strategies to support organisational objectives.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ify and solve complex data challenges.
- Oversee the design, development, and deployment of predictive models and algorithms.
- Ensure compliance with data governance and ethical guidelines in all analytics activities.
- Provide mentorship and professional development opportunities for team members.
- Communicate findings and actionable insights to senior leadership and key stakeholders.
- Select and apply the most appropriate analysis, data science and statistical techniques given the research objectives and the data.
- Develop appropriate analytical methods in firm-based risk assessment and thematic risks.
- Provide internal consultancy across Directorates and Programmes on analytical methods and techniques.
- Stay informed about industry trends and emerging technologies in the public sector.
Profile
A successful Head of Data Science should have:
- Proven experience in data science and analytics, ideally within the public sector or regulatory body.
- A strong background in statistical modelling, machine learning, and data visualisation tools.
- Expert use of standard statistical tools e.g. R/Python and relevant associated libraries.
- Deep expertise in building and maintaining AI and machine learning models, including use of deep learning, natural language processing, and LLMs.
- Excellent leadership and team management skills.
- A solid understanding of data governance and ethical considerations.
- Outstanding communication skills to present complex data in an accessible manner.
- A degree or equivalent qualification in data science, mathematics, or a related field.
- Demonstrated ability to collaborate across departments and with senior stakeholders.
Job Offer
- Competitive salary range of £65,000 to £77,000 (London) per annum.
- 25 days of annual leave, increasing to 27 after 2 years of service.
- Generous pension contributions (up to 19.25%).
- Income protection, life assurance and Private Medical benefits.
- 3% of annual salary available for additional benefits, including dental insurance and travel insurance.
- Opportunities to work on meaningful projects within the public sector in Birmingham.
